- package.json: remove @tensorflow/tfjs and @tensorflow/tfjs-node. Monster's TF code was already stripped; the deps were stale and kept pulling a heavy native binary back into every install. - .gitignore: ignore .repo-mem/ regenerable indexes and per-session .claude/*.lock runtime files. - CLAUDE.md: prepend READ-FIRST pointer to .claude/rules/repo-mem.md; collapse the 'three outputs' bullet to a pointer at node-architecture. - .claude/rules/telemetry.md: drop Port 0/1/2 duplication; reference node-architecture.md. - .claude/rules/testing.md: stop requiring a separate test/edge tier and the basic/integration/edge example flow trio. Reflects what nodes actually do. - .claude/rules/repo-mem.md (new): when-to-call-which guide for the per-repo memory MCP, anti-patterns, refresh model. - .mcp.json (new): wire repo-mem stdio server. - docs/DEVELOPER_GUIDE.md (new): step-by-step guide for adding a new EVOLV node under the three-layer pattern. - Bump nodes/pumpingStation to 6ab585b (docs + simulations refresh, spill-flow path renames consistent with d8490aa).
